CA 9460O 415-465.1100 <br /> February 10, 1988 <br /> Julian Munoz, plant Engineer <br /> Safeway Stores <br /> 1111 Navy Drive <br /> Stockton, CA 95024 <br /> Re: Subsurface investigation <br /> Stockton, California <br /> 4.A Job No. 44-245-03 <br /> Dear Mr. Munoz: <br /> This letter presents the results of the tank backfill excavation and "oil <br /> sampling conducted on 22 and 23 January 1988 by Weiss Associates (WA) and <br /> Precision Industries of Stockton, CA (PI) at the Safeway Meat Packing facility <br /> at 1111 Navy Drive Stoc}:ton, California. As deta4.1ed in our 13 November 1987 <br /> proposal, the work consisted of: <br /> 1) Removing the backfill from the excavation; <br /> 1 <br /> 2) Stockpiling the backfill on site; <br /> 3) Analyzing samples of native soil adjacent to the excavation; and <br /> 4) Preparing a report. <br /> Project background, descriptions of each task, analytic results, conclusions, <br /> and a proposal for closure of the excavation are discussed below. <br /> BACKGROUND <br /> tour 12,000-gallon underground diesel tanks located along the southern <br /> property line adjacent to Navy Drive were removed by PI between 6 July and 10 <br /> August 1987.
